WebAn operational Windshear and Turbulence Warning System (WTWS) was developed for Hong Kong's NewAirport at Chek Lap Kok. The WTWS provides alerts for terrain–and convective–induced windshear and turbulence. The system has been utilized by air traffic controllers and pilots since opening day, 6 July 1998. Looking at the best failure modes for the total (forward-looking, predictive, and reactive) system, the forward or predictive systems should not operate without a reactive system. Yet, the reactive system must operate without the fornard or predictive systems.

WebSep 5, 2006 · Both reactive and predictive windshear systems use a NASA defined hazard factor called the “F-factor.” It may be defined as follows; F = Wh G - Vd As Where Wh is the rate of airspeed loss in kts per seconds, g is gravity, Vd is the vertical down draft rate, and As is the aircraft airspeed. While the A320 FCOM states WINDSHEAR DETECTION FUNCTION is done by the FAC. How does … phn location mapWebA reactive windshear warning system is available on most aircraft models. This system is capable to detect a windshear encounter based on a measure of wind velocities, both vertically and horizontally. When it activates, the audio “WINDSHEAR” is repeated 3 times, and a red “WINDSHEAR” warning appears on the PFD. phnl notams
